Vulnerable environments need specialized safety measures to protect individuals from potential harm. A critical aspect of this protection involves eliminating possible ligature points, which are often found in common objects like clocks. Common clocks can pose a significant risk as their straps or hands can be used for self-harm or other dangerous activities. Ligature-resistant safety clocks resolve this problem by incorporating design features that eliminate these susceptible points.

These clocks are typically designed with solid bodies, and their hands are securely attached. The absence of removable parts limits the risk of ligature use, creating a safer environment for individuals who may be susceptible to self-harm or violence.

By implementing ligature-resistant safety clocks in vulnerable environments such as mental health facilities, correctional institutions, and schools, we can significantly reduce the risk of harm and create a more secure environment for all.

Safeguarding Individuals at Risk: The Importance of Ligature-Resistant Clocks

In facilities where residents may be at risk of self-harm or harm to others, safety is paramount. While various measures are in place to ensure a secure environment, the seemingly innocuous clock can pose a hidden danger. Traditional clocks, with their easily accessible hands and hanging mechanisms, can be used as ligature points, presenting a serious threat to vulnerable individuals. This is where secure clocks become crucial.

These specialized clocks are constructed with features that reduce the risk of ligature use. They often feature reinforced materials, integrated hanging points, and non-removable faces. By mitigating these potential hazards, ligature-resistant clocks contribute a valuable layer of protection in securing the well-being of residents entrusted to our care.

Selecting Safe Clocks

In demanding environments where safety is paramount, choosing the appropriate equipment becomes crucial. Safety clocks, especially those designed to be safe, play a critical role in mitigating risks. These clocks are constructed with robust features that prevent them from being used as instruments for harm. When selecting a ligature-resistant safety clock, consider factors such as the strength of the housing, the design of the face, and the installation options available.

  • Emphasize clocks with a solid plastic body.
  • Guarantee the display are securely attached and challenging to remove.
  • Opt for clocks with a reliable attachment system that prevents them from being easily dislodged.

By making an informed choice, you can choose a ligature-resistant safety clock that efficiently enhances security and preserves the well-being of individuals in your care.
